Market Overview - On October 22, the trading volume of the Shanghai and Shenzhen stock markets reached 1.67 trillion, a decrease of 224.8 billion compared to the previous trading day [1] - Sectors that saw significant gains included deep earth economy concepts, plant-based meat, wind power equipment, and real estate, while precious metals and battery sectors experienced declines [1] Stock Performance - High-performing stocks included Dayou Energy with 9 consecutive trading limits, *ST Nan Zhi with 9 days of gains, and *ST Wan Fang with 8 days of gains [3] - The top three net purchases on the daily leaderboard were Keri Technology, Asia-Pacific Pharmaceutical, and Marco Polo, with net purchases of 140 million, 127 million, and 90.2 million respectively [3] Institutional Activity - The top three net sales on the daily leaderboard were Hezhu Intelligent, Haima Automobile, and Deshi Co., with net sales of 118 million, 99.5 million, and 96.2 million respectively [4] - Among stocks involving institutional special seats, the top three net purchases were Rongxin Culture, Kebo Da, and Te Yi Pharmaceutical, with net purchases of 111 million, 41.7 million, and 39.1 million respectively [4] Company Highlights Keri Technology - Positioned as a provider of mid-to-late stage solutions for lithium battery manufacturing equipment, the company has seen significant growth in its XR/VR testing equipment, which has been shipped in bulk to leading clients [5] - For the first half of the year, the company reported revenue of 1.106 billion and a net profit of 123 million, with revenue growth of 6.31% and net profit growth of 37.28% year-on-year, indicating notable performance improvement [6] Asia-Pacific Pharmaceutical - Announced a change in control with the major shareholder, Fubon Group, planning to transfer 14.62% of shares to Xinghao Holdings at 8.26 yuan per share, totaling 900 million [7] - The company plans to raise up to 700 million through a private placement to fund the development of oncolytic virus drugs and long-acting complex formulations, transitioning from traditional generics to improved new drugs and innovative drugs [7] Hezhu Intelligent - Recently won a bid for the fusion energy BEST vacuum chamber project worth 209 million and is forming a specialized team to tackle core components of fusion reactors [9] - The company's color sorting machines account for 57% of its revenue, with 20-25% of this business coming from exports, maintaining a strong position in the domestic market [9] Key Trading Stocks - Rongxin Culture saw a 3.56% increase with a turnover rate of 45.97% and a total transaction volume of 809 million, with institutional net purchases of 111 million [10] - Sanwei Communication increased by 5.00% with a turnover rate of 33.08% and a total transaction volume of 3.005 billion, with institutional net purchases of 23 million [10] - Te Yi Pharmaceutical hit the daily limit with a turnover rate of 30.11% and a total transaction volume of 1.201 billion, with institutional net purchases of 39.1 million [10]

Market Performance - On October 22, 2025, the Shanghai Composite Index fell by 0.07%, the Shenzhen Component Index decreased by 0.62%, and the ChiNext Index dropped by 0.79%[2] - The total market turnover was 16,902.59 billion CNY, a decrease of 2,024.34 billion CNY compared to the previous trading day[2] - Out of 5,246 stocks, 2,280 rose while 2,966 fell[2] Sector and Style Analysis - The top-performing sectors included Oil & Petrochemicals (1.55%), Banking (0.94%), and Real Estate (0.88%)[22] - The worst-performing sectors were Agriculture, Forestry, Animal Husbandry, and Fishery (-1.53%), Nonferrous Metals (-1.42%), and Electric Power Equipment & New Energy (-1.13%)[22] - In terms of investment style, Financials outperformed, followed by Stability, while Growth and Cyclical sectors lagged[22] Capital Flow - On October 22, 2025, the net outflow of main funds was 442.31 billion CNY, with large orders seeing a net outflow of 224.43 billion CNY and super large orders a net outflow of 217.89 billion CNY[27] - Small orders continued to see a net inflow of 424.83 billion CNY[27] ETF Trading Activity - Major ETFs such as the Huaxia SSE 50 ETF and the Huatai-PB CSI 300 ETF saw significant decreases in trading volume, with changes of -1.86 billion CNY and -19.10 billion CNY respectively[31] - The total trading volume for these ETFs was 24.91 billion CNY for the Huaxia SSE 50 ETF and 26.02 billion CNY for the Huatai-PB CSI 300 ETF[31] Global Market Overview - On October 22, 2025, major Asia-Pacific indices closed mixed, with the Hang Seng Index down 0.94% and the Nikkei 225 down 0.02%[36] - European indices generally rose on October 21, 2025, with the DAX up 0.29% and the CAC40 up 0.64%[36]
